Spring Branch
Spring Branch is a stream in Greenwood, South Carolina. Spring Branch is situated nearby to the hamlet Springdale, as well as near Colonial Heights.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Ninety Six
Town
Photo: Acroterion, CC BY-SA 4.0.
Ninety Six is a town of 2,000 people in Upcountry South Carolina. Ninety Six benefits from tourism to its historic site and nearby state park, along with events such as the Festival of Stars, a Fourth of July celebration that is hosted yearly by the town. Ninety Six is situated 2½ miles north of Spring Branch.
